Processor

1.

Prepare the computer for disassembly (see

Preparing to disassemble the HP TouchSmart PC

on page 11

).

2.

Place the computer face down on a soft, flat surface.

3.

Remove the hard drive/memory cover (see

Hard drive/memory cover on page 12

).

4.

Remove the stand (see

Stand on page 15

).

5.

Remove the I/O cover (see

I/O cover on page 13

).

6.

Remove the feet (see

Feet on page 14

).

7.

Remove the hard drive (see

Removing the hard drive on page 19

).

8.

Remove the back cover (see

Back cover on page 20

).
